Definition of Hiss
Hiss

To make with the mouth a prolonged sound like that of the letter s, by driving the breath between the tongue and the teeth; to make with the mouth a sound like that made by a goose or a snake when angered; esp., to make such a sound as an expression of hatred, passion, or disapproval.

To make a similar noise by any means; to pass with a sibilant sound; as, the arrow hissed as it flew.

To condemn or express contempt for by hissing.

To utter with a hissing sound.

A prolonged sound like that letter s, made by forcing out the breath between the tongue and teeth, esp. as a token of disapprobation or contempt.

Any sound resembling that above described

The noise made by a serpent.

The note of a goose when irritated.

The noise made by steam escaping through a narrow orifice, or by water falling on a hot stove.
